Most online tools work like this: you enter injury categories and costs, and the calculator outputs an estimated value range. That can be helpful early on, especially when you’re trying to budget while treatment is beginning.
But calculators struggle with the issues that frequently come up in East Bay motorcycle crashes, including:
- Shared fault arguments (common in California when insurers claim lane position, speed, or reaction time was unreasonable)
- Causation disputes when symptoms evolve over weeks (insurers look closely at medical timing and consistency)
- “Treatment gap” challenges if appointments are delayed due to work, scheduling, or referrals
- Policy limit pressure when the at-fault driver’s coverage is limited
A Moraga settlement often depends less on the headline injury label and more on how well your records connect the crash to your ongoing limitations.
